Daily Writing Prompts for June

First off, here are 30 writing prompts, one for each day of the month, perfect for June in any part of the world. These writing ideas talk up the month’s significance as the midpoint of the year.

Feel free to adapt and modify these prompts to suit your writing style and interests. Whether you’re reflecting on personal growth, setting intentions, or exploring the symbolism of the midpoint of the year, these prompts will inspire you to engage with the significance of June and the journey through the year.

  1. Reflect on the goals and intentions you set at the beginning of the year. Write a personal essay discussing your progress, challenges, and adjustments as you reach the midpoint of the year.
  2. Imagine you’re hosting a “Mid-Year Review” party. Write an invitation encouraging friends and loved ones to gather and reflect on their achievements and growth thus far.
  3. Write a poem that captures the essence of June as a transitional month, symbolizing change, growth, and the anticipation of the second half of the year.
  4. Reflect on the significance of the summer solstice (or winter), which occurs in June, and write a personal narrative about how the longest day (or shortest) of the year influences your mindset and perspective.
  5. Write a letter to your future self, envisioning where you hope to be by the end of the year and outlining the steps you’ll take to achieve your goals.
  6. Imagine you’re a coach or mentor. Write a motivational message to inspire others to seize the opportunity of the midpoint and reignite their passion and determination to achieve their aspirations.
  7. Reflect on the lessons you’ve learned in the first half of the year. Write an essay discussing the insights gained and how they’ll guide your actions and decisions moving forward.
  8. Write a short story set in June, exploring themes of personal transformation, new beginnings, or unexpected encounters that shape the lives of the characters.
  9. Create a list of “mid-year resolutions,” offering practical and meaningful actions readers can take to make the second half of the year more fulfilling and productive.
  10. Reflect on the changing seasons and how they mirror the ebb and flow of life. Write a reflective piece drawing parallels between nature’s cycles and our own journeys through the year.
  11. Write a letter to someone who has had a significant impact on your life in the past six months, expressing gratitude and sharing how their influence has shaped your personal growth.
  12. Imagine you’re planning a “Mid-Year Reset Retreat.” Write a detailed itinerary, outlining activities, workshops, and practices that will help participants reflect, recharge, and set new intentions.
  13. Write a reflective piece about the concept of time and its perception as we reach the midpoint of the year, exploring the ways in which time can be both fleeting and abundant.
  14. Reflect on the themes of balance and harmony in life. Write an essay discussing how you will strive for equilibrium in different areas of your life during the second half of the year.
  15. Write a series of affirmations to inspire and motivate others as they enter the midpoint of the year, encouraging them to embrace their potential and pursue their dreams.
  16. Imagine you’re a journalist covering a “Mid-Year Insights” conference. Write an article summarizing the key takeaways, trends, and expert advice shared at the event.
  17. Reflect on the importance of self-care and write a guide to creating a personalized self-care plan for the remaining months of the year, emphasizing the need to nurture one’s physical, mental, and emotional well-being.
  18. Write a list of recommended books or resources for personal and professional growth that can inspire and support individuals at the midpoint of the year.
  19. Reflect on the changes in nature during the month of June and write a descriptive piece capturing the beauty and symbolism of the new season.
  20. Write a series of journaling prompts to encourage self-reflection and introspection as individuals reach the midpoint of the year, inviting them to explore their desires, fears, and aspirations.
  21. Reflect on the concept of resilience and write an essay about how setbacks and challenges in the first half of the year have shaped your resilience and determination to succeed.
  22. Write a letter to a younger version of yourself, offering advice and words of encouragement as you reflect on the midpoint of the year and the wisdom you’ve gained.
  1. Imagine you are creating a vision board or collage that represents your aspirations and goals for the second half of the year, using images, quotes, and symbols that inspire and motivate you. Describe it in vivid detail.
  2. Write a reflective piece about the power of gratitude and the importance of acknowledging and appreciating the blessings and achievements of the first half of the year.
  3. Imagine you’re a time traveler visiting the midpoint of the year from the future. Write a letter to yourself in the present, sharing insights and lessons learned that can guide you in the coming months.
  4. Reflect on the changing daylight hours and the impact it has on your daily routines and mood. Write a personal essay exploring how the shift in daylight affects your perspective and energy.
  5. Write a series of prompts to inspire creativity and exploration during the second half of the year, encouraging readers to engage in artistic endeavors or pursue new hobbies.
  6. Reflect on the importance of community and collaboration in achieving personal and collective goals. Write an essay discussing how you will seek support and contribute to your communities in the coming months.
  7. Write a letter to the Universe or a higher power, expressing your gratitude for the experiences of the past six months and setting intentions for the future.
  8. Imagine you’re a motivational speaker delivering a powerful message about embracing the midpoint of the year as a fresh start and an opportunity for growth and transformation. Write the transcript of your speech.

June Prompts for Summer

Beyond these 30 daily writing prompts, here are other topics you might consider. First off, for those of us going into summer:

Summer Travel Destinations: Share your experience with thehottest summer vacation spots, your favorite hidden gems, and wallet-friendly destinations. You can also give personal tips for planning trips, packing essentials, and must-see attractions.

Outdoor Activities: Write about embracing the great outdoors with thrilling summer activities like hiking, camping, kayaking, or beach outings. You could also provide safety tips, gear recommendations, and highlight the benefits of spending time in nature.

Summer Fashion and Style: Discuss staying stylish and beating the heat with the latest summer fashion trends. the latest summer fashion trends, outfit ideas, and tips for staying stylish in the heat. Include suggestions for lightweight fabrics, accessories, and essential summer wardrobe staples.

Gardening and Landscaping: Offer your personal advice on gardening, landscaping, and sprucing up your outdoor spaces in the summer. Share tips on growing specific plants, creating vibrant gardens, and designing functional backyards that will make your neighbors green with envy.

Summer Recipes and Refreshments: Share refreshing recipes that quench your thirst and satisfy your taste buds. These can include refreshing summer beverages, mouthwatering barbecue dishes, salads, and irresistible frozen treats. You can write about healthy options, easy-to-make recipes, and creative ways to make the most of seasonal produce.

Father’s Day Gift Ideas: Write about unique and thoughtful gifts for Father’s Day, showcasing unique and thoughtful presents for dads. This could be in the form of a gift guide with different categories with gadget suggestions, book recommendations, unforgettable experiences, and personalized presents that will make Dad’s day extra special.

Summer Health and Fitness: Discuss staying in tip-top shape this summer with our health and fitness tips. You can cover topics such as hydration hacks and sunscreen essentials to outdoor workout ideas and nutritious recipes for picnics and barbecues.

Summer Reading List: Recommend captivating books across various genres with selections from your own curated summer reading list. You can provide reviews, summaries, and recommendations for fiction lovers, non-fiction enthusiasts, and even young readers.

World Environment Day: Celebrate World Environment Day on June 5th by writing about environmental issue awareness and exploring sustainable living practices. You can offer tips for reducing waste, conserving energy, and supporting eco-friendly businesses to make a positive impact on our planet.

Graduation and Education: With many school graduations happening in May and June, it’s a perfect time to write about topics related to graduations, education, or career development. You can offer advice for recent graduates to inspiring success stories and discussions about the future of education.

June Prompts for Winter

If you’re in the Southern Hemisphere, here are some potential writing prompt themes specially tailored for the month of June as the first month of the year’s winter season:

Winter Fashion Essentials: Share your favorite must-have clothing items and accessories for staying stylish and warm during the winter season.

Winter Travel Destinations: You can write about incredible destinations in the southern hemisphere that are perfect for a winter getaway. Provide travel tips, recommendations, and hidden gems.

Indoor Activities for Cold Days: Write about fun and engaging indoor activities to beat the winter blues. Include ideas for family-friendly activities, hobbies, crafts, or cozy movie nights.

Embracing Hygge: Explore the Danish concept of hygge and how it can be embraced during the winter months. Share tips on creating a cozy, comforting atmosphere at home.

Winter Wellness Tips: Offer advice on maintaining physical and mental well-being during the colder season. Discuss self-care routines, winter exercise ideas, and ways to boost mood and energy levels.

Winter Recipes and Comfort Foods: Share your favorite delicious recipes perfect for winter, such as hearty soups, warming beverages, and comforting desserts. Include tips for seasonal ingredients and cooking techniques.

Winter Gardening: Provide guidance on how to care for plants and gardens during the colder months. Offer tips on winter-friendly plants, indoor gardening, and ways to protect outdoor plants from the cold.

Winter Photography Tips: Help readers capture the beauty of the winter season through photography. Share your favorite techniques, composition ideas, and tips for capturing stunning winter landscapes.

Celebrating Winter Festivals: Explore the diverse winter festivals celebrated in the southern hemisphere. Discuss their origins, traditions, and unique cultural aspects.

Winter Home Décor Ideas: Offer inspiration for transforming homes into cozy winter retreats. Share select tips on using textures, warm colors, lighting, and accessories to create a welcoming ambiance.
